How to defer loading of JavaScript?

How add defer in JavaScript?

The DEFER Method

You could add the “defer” attribute to each of your external <script src=’…’></script> tags. What the ‘defer’ attribute does is tell the web browser to not load it until the HTML has finished loading.

How do I defer parsing of JavaScript?

2. Defer Parsing of JavaScript in WordPress

  1. Go to your WordPress Dashboard.
  2. On the left sidebar, navigate to Speed Booster.
  3. Click the Advanced tab, and activate Defer parsing of JS files.
  4. Once done, tap Save Changes.

What does defer mean in JavaScript?

Definition and Usage

The defer attribute is a boolean attribute. When present, it specifies that the script is executed when the page has finished parsing. Note: The defer attribute is only for external scripts (should only be used if the src attribute is present).

What is the difference between asynchronously loading a script file and deferring the loading of the script file?

The difference between async and defer centers around when the script is executed. Each async script executes at the first opportunity after it is finished downloading and before the window’s load event. … Whereas the defer scripts, on the other hand, are guaranteed to be executed in the order they occur in the page.

Which is better async or defer?

Scripts loaded with ASYNC are parsed and executed immediately when the resource is done downloading. Whereas DEFER scripts don’t execute until the HTML document is done being parsed (AKA, DOM Interactive or performance. timing. … Even though ASYNC and DEFER don’t block the HTML parser, they can block rendering.

See also:  How to turn JavaScript on iphone?

How do you use defer?

Defer sentence examples

  1. “You must defer to him in my absence as you do me,” he reminded her. …
  2. consented to defer his Crusade until March 1222. …
  3. There was still no improvement in the countess’ health, but it was impossible to defer the journey to Moscow any longer.

How do I defer parsing JavaScript in Shopify?

Defer parsing of JavaScript in Shopify

You would need to edit your theme. liquid file and find all the script tags on the page. Then move them to the head and add defer. Always backup your site before doing manual edits!

How do you minify JavaScript?

Recommendations

  1. To minify HTML, try HTMLMinifier.
  2. To minify CSS, try CSSNano and csso.
  3. To minify JavaScript, try UglifyJS. The Closure Compiler is also very effective. You can create a build process that uses these tools to minify and rename the development files and save them to a production directory.

What’s the use of Await function with an example?

The await keyword causes the JavaScript runtime to pause your code on this line, allowing other code to execute in the meantime, until the async function call has returned its result. Once that’s complete, your code continues to execute starting on the next line. For example: let response = await fetch(‘coffee.19 мая 2020 г.

What does defer mean?

1. Defer, delay, postpone imply keeping something from occurring until a future time. To defer is to decide to do something later on: to defer making a payment. To delay is sometimes equivalent to defer, but usually it is to act in a dilatory manner and thus lay something aside: to delay one’s departure.

See also:  How to import jquery in JavaScript?

When would you use async defer?

In practice, defer is used for scripts that need the whole DOM and/or their relative execution order is important. And async is used for independent scripts, like counters or ads. And their relative execution order does not matter.

What’s JavaScript used for?

JavaScript is a text-based programming language used both on the client-side and server-side that allows you to make web pages interactive. Where HTML and CSS are languages that give structure and style to web pages, JavaScript gives web pages interactive elements that engage a user.

When should I load Javascript?

Because of the fact that browsers have to pause displaying content of a page when it’s parsing a Javascript file, the recommendation is to load the Javascript at the bottom of the page to speed up displaying a page’s content.

How can I make Javascript load faster?

Speed Up Your Javascript Load Time

  1. Find The Flab. Like any optimization technique, it helps to measure and figure out what parts are taking the longest. …
  2. Compress Your Javascript. …
  3. Debugging Compressed Javascript. …
  4. Eliminating Tedium. …
  5. Optimize Javascript Placement. …
  6. Load Javascript On-Demand. …
  7. Delay Your Javascript. …
  8. Cache Your Files.

Leave a Comment

Your email address will not be published. Required fields are marked *